GW2. Best Open World Build. Pistol / Scepter Catalyst. Elementalist PvE.
Last Update: April 2024
The Celestial Catalyst is an elementalist build for open world PvE that has consistent ranged damage with great boon application and survivability, making it one of the easier builds for beginners to the elementalist class. Pistol skills are all generally projectiles which means that most attunements have the same skills, and therefore it is more forgiving to get lost in the rotation. However, this also means the pistol may not feel as interactive as other weapons even though they deal extremely potent condition damage.
Pistol skills grant you ammo and expend ammo when using the 2 and 3 skills. When using a pistol skills with an ammo charge, you empower that skill to have an added effect. Because you generally use the 2 and 3 skill once per attunement swap, you can think of the rotation as prioritizing the order of which skill you want to empower by using that skill second in the rotation since the other skill will obtain the ammo for it.
Conveniently, most of the 2 skills on pistol do more damage when empowered, except for in water attunement, so to maximize your damage you would prefer to use 3 > 2, but in Water use 2 > 3. However, in some cases you will want to use the opposite order for more sustain such as 3 > 2 in Water giving you extra healing, 2 > 3 in Earth giving you Barrier, and 2 > 3 in Fire giving you an aura. Otherwise, the order in which you swap attunements is not too important except for going Earth after Fire and Air after Water to maximize your combo field/finisher potential. As a catalyst, performing these combos can give you auras which will also increase all of your stats. You can also use the Jade Sphere to create more fields, but mainly the F5 will be used to upkeep Protection, Might, and Quickness.
Example Pistol Rotation:
- Signet of Fire > Signet of Earth
- Water 2 > 3 > Swap Air
- Air 3 > 2 > 4 > 5 > Swap Fire
- Fire F5 + 3 > 2 > 5 > 4 > Swap Earth
- Earth F5 + 3 > 2 > 5 > 4 (if possible use Elemental Celerity then 3 > 2 > 5 > 4 again)
At any point in your rotation, prioritize using the Signet utilities for more damage or for healing as they are more powerful than any specific skill you could use. Fire and Earth Signet do great damage over time, the Heal signet passive will persist while on cooldown due to the Written in Stone trait, and the Signet of Air will break stuns on a low cooldown so use it liberally.
To survive you want to time your Air 3 and 5 for their evades, use the Water 4 and 5, or use your catalyst energy to create a Water Jade Sphere which you can swap into Earth to blast with the 4/5 in the Water Field.
